Climate & Weather in Hong Kong

Flag of Hong Kong
 

Hong Kong's climate is generally sub-tropical, but for big part of the year tending towards temperate and characterized by four distinguishable seasons. Spring months (March and May) are usually warm and humid with often fog and drizzle. Summer (June to mid September) features hot and humid air and frequent rains and thunderstorms. September is the typhoon season in Hong Kong. Winters (December to February) are cool and dry with average temperatures around 17°C / 63°F.
